Corefactors vs Kantree: Revenue, Funding & Team Size Compared

Corefactors generates $369.2K in revenue; Kantree generates $360K. Corefactors and Kantree are close to the same size by revenue. The table below compares Corefactors and Kantree on funding, valuation, customers, team size and headquarters — every figure GetLatka has verified for each company.

Corefactors, founded in 2013, is a powerful CRM platform crafted to enhance RevOps and business efficiency. It brings together customer touchpoints, aligns teams, and eliminates revenue leakages with a seamless 360° view of operations…
